Re: Mouse Supplies List
I only refill their bowl when they've eaten most of it. That way they're not just picking out favorites, yet food is always available. I make sure to look around the tank too for any piles of hidden food and I also pay close attention to how much food has gone to waste at every weekly clean. If there's a lot, I know to cut back on how much I'm refilling. If there is none, I know I'm not refilling enough.

Re: Mouse Supplies List
The 6.5 inch Silent Spinner is big enough for most mice. Not sure if that's what you have now, but thought I'd mention it just in case. That's really the smallest wheel recommended.
He's adorable! Yogurt drops are usually full of sugar (though there is a sugar free kind out there). I mostly skip pet store treats. They're just as pleased with healthier things like bits of fresh veggies, walnuts, pumpkin seeds, cheerios, mealworms, nori, puffed rice. Cleaning the tank out weekly is perfect. You can spot clean in between if needed.
